If it isn't available, it is because Microsoft has evaluated your system not to be ready for Windows 10. Usually, it is because you'll face with all sorts of driver problems, at least that is why Microsoft testing concluded. You have to wait sometimes i August. However, nothing stops you to force upgrade if you really want Win10 now, or see if the issues will really affect you or not.
